Determination of 20 Heavy Metals and Trace Elements in Lonicera Japonica and Lonicera Hypoglauca by ICP-MS

Abstract: Objective To develop a method for the determination of a total of 20 elements such as plumbum (Pb), copper (Cu), arsenic (As), cadmium (Cd), mercury (Hg), manganese (Mn), nickel (Ni), thalliu (Tl) in Lonicera japonica and Lonicera hypoglauca. Methods The samples were digested by microwave-assisted method and then chose appropriate determination parameters of ICP-MS, using Ge and In as the internal standard. Results All the correlation coefficients exceeded 0.9993, showing good linearities over the concentration range. The lower limit of detection of the assay ranged from 0.004 to 0.071 μg·L-1. The method exhibited good precision and accuracy, while the recoveries ranged from 80% to 100%. Conclusion The method is simple, accurate and highly sensitive, successfully applied to rapid monitoring the multi-elements in Lonicera japonica and Lonicera hypoglauca for the quality control and identification.
